Information theft is big business today. Malevolent hackers break into business networks to steal credit card or social security numbers for profit. Small and medium-sized businesses are at risk because they are seen as an easier mark than large corporations. Protecting the perimeter of the network is a good start, but it is not enough, since many information thefts have help from a trusted insider, such as an employee or contractor. Information theft can be costly to small and medium-sized businesses, since they rely on satisfied customers and a good reputation to help grow their business. Businesses that do not adequately protect their information could face negative publicity, government fines, or even lawsuits. For example, new consumer laws enacted in California require any business that suspects customer information has been viewed by unauthorized people must notify ALL their customers. Any security strategy must prevent theft of sensitive electronic information from both inside and outside the business.

Network security involves all activities that organizations, enterprises, and institutions undertake to protect the value and ongoing usability of assets and the integrity and continuity of operations. An effective network security strategy requires identifying threats and then choosing the most effective set of tools to combat them.

In recent years, security needs have intensified. Data communications and e-commerce are reshaping business practices and introducing new threats to corporate activity. National defense is also vulnerable as national infrastructure systems, for example transport and energy distribution, could be the target of terrorists or, in times of war, enemy nation states. On a less dramatic note, reasons why organisations need to devise effective network security strategies include the following: (1) Security breaches can be very expensive in terms of business disruption and the financial losses that may result, (2) Increasing volumes of sensitive information are transferred across the internet or intranets connected to it, (3) Networks that make use of internet links are becoming more popular because they are cheaper than dedicated leased lines. This, however, involves different users sharing internet links to transport their data, and (4) Directors of business organizations are increasingly required to provide effective information security. For an organization to achieve the level of security that is appropriate and at a cost that is acceptable, it must carry out a detailed risk assessment to determine the nature and extent of existing and potential threats. Countermeasures to the perceived threats must balance the degree of security to be achieved with their acceptability to system users and the value of the data systems to be protected.
